Gaiwan, also known as zhong, in Chinese porcelain.

The Gaiwan is a tea accessory that made its appearance during the Ming dynasty around 1350.

It is used as a teapot: water is poured inside and then the leaves are thrown in. The lid serves as a filter, to stop the leaves when pouring the liquid into a cup. The gaiwan is mainly used for the infusion of green, white, and black teas. Instead, for oolong and pu erh, Yixing teapots and cups are preferred. The size of the gaiwan allows the leaf to not be constrained by a filter and give its best.

The simplicity and elegance of this tea accessory reflect well the Chinese tea culture.

Gaiwan capacity 120 ml.
